Press Gazette started in 1965 as a trade journal for journalists and editors across the UK but has evolved into an online source for media leaders covering all sectors of the global news and media industries, from the national and regional press (both in print and online) to radio, TV, digital, B2B and consumer magazines. It also covers media law and media technology.
As well as all the essential news, Press Gazette’s content pillars include audience and business data, tech platforms and their relationships with publishers, interviews with media leaders and others who are working to create a sustainable future for media, and the weekly podcast The Future of Media Explained. Press Gazette reaches more than 350,000 readers a month via pressgazette.co.uk, and a further 20,000 through its daily and weekly newsletters.
Press Gazette’s events include the British Journalism Awards, which have been running for 11 years and are the only event to cover every sector of the UK news industry. More recently it has launched the Future of Media Technology Conference and Awards, the Media 100 Networking event for C-level decision makers as well as the Future of Media Trends roundtables.
In 2022 Press Gazette’s events attracted more than 1,000 senior industry leaders across leadership, operations, product, revenue, marketing, digital, content, data, audience insight and technology at every major publisher and media group across the UK.
